4800-5800竖曲线高程计算程序
CASIO fx—4800P测设竖曲线
1.竖曲线测设计算公式:
如上图,竖曲线各基本要素可用下列近似公式求:
L=R(i1-i2)=2T
T=T1=T2=1/2R(i1-i2)
E=T2÷2R
Y=X2÷2R
式中:R—竖曲线半径
i1、i2—相邻坡道的坡度
L—竖曲线的长度(m)
T—竖曲线的切线长(m)
E—竖曲线的外矢距(m)
X—竖曲线上任意一点距其起点或终点的水平距离(m)
Y—竖曲线上任意一点距切线的纵距,即标高改正值(m)
上式中Y值在凹形竖曲线中为正号,在凸形竖曲线中为负号
2.程序源
SQX
T=0.5Abs(C"i1"-D"i2")R
E=T2÷(2R)◢ G "L1"=F"L0"-T◢ U "L2"=F+T◢
Lbl1: H "H0":X=N-G:{N}:
C-D<0=﹥J=1:≠﹥J=-1:K"G"=H-CT+JX2÷(2R)+CX◢
I:S:M: "Z=":Z=K+SI-M◢
Goto1
3.算例
某线路i1=-1.114%,i2=+0.154%,为凹形竖曲线,变坡点桩号为K2+670,高程为48.60m,欲设置R=5000m的竖曲线,求各测设元素,起、终点桩号和高程,曲线上每10m间距里程桩设计高程。
按上列公式求得:
L=R(i1-i2)=2T=63.4m
T=T1=T2=1/2R(i1-i2)=31.70m
E=T2÷2R=0.10m
竖曲线起、终点的桩号和高程为:
起点桩号=2+(670-31.70)=2+638.30
终点桩号=2+(670+31.70)=2+701.70
起点坡度高程:48.60+31.7×1.114%=48.95m
终点坡度高程:48.60+31.7×0.154%=48.65m
竖曲线各桩高程计算
里 程 距起点距x 竖曲线高程 备注
2+638.30 X=0 48.95 竖起
2+650 X=11.7 48.84
2+660 X=21.7 48.76
2+670 X=31.7 48.70 变坡点
2+680 X=41.7 48.66
2+690 X=51.7 48.64
2+701.7 X=63.4 48.65 竖终
4.利用程序进行计算
步骤 键操作 显示 说 明
1 AC — 开机、清零
2 FILE… SQX 调出程序
3 EXE i1? 要求输入坡度i1
4 i1 EXE i2? 输入i1,要求输入坡度i2
5 i2 EXE R? 输入i2,要求输入竖曲线半径R
6 R EXE T=… 输入R,显示竖曲线切线长度
7 EXE E=… 显示竖曲线外矢距
8 EXE L0? 要求输入变坡点里程L0
9 L0 EXE L1 输入L0,显示切点(起点)里程
10 EXE L2 显示终点里程
11 EXE H0? 要求输入变坡点切线标高
12 H0 EXE N? 输入H0,要求输入所求设计标高点的里程N
13 N EXE G=… 显示所求里程设计标高
14 EXE N? 要求输入下一个所求设计标高点的里程N
15 N EXE G=… 显示所求下一个里程点标高,以下继续求完为止
5.程序说明
该程序可以计算竖曲线设计标高,并可以根据实际需要调整竖曲线。2009-6-24
6.fx-5800
"i1"?C:"i2"?D:?R:"L0"?F:"H0"?H:"T=":.5abs(C-D)R->T◢
"E=":T2÷(2R)->E◢ "L1=":F-T->G◢ "L2=":F+T=U◢
Lb11:?L:"x=":L-G->X◢
IFC-D<0:Then1->J:Else-1->J:
IFend:"H=":H-CT+Jx÷(2R)+CX->K◢
? I:?S:?M: "Z=":K+SI-M->Z◢
Goto1
说明:i1、i2、I分别为纵坡、横坡;l0、h0为变点桩号、高程;L1、L2为竖曲线起讫桩号
;S为所求点边距;M为路面厚度。
2010-05-10王选成于山西忻州